Vitamin C is a water-soluble vitamin, meaning that your body doesn't store it. You need vitamin C for the growth and repair of tissues in all parts of your body. It helps the body make collagen, an important protein used to make skin, cartilage, tendons, ligaments, and blood vessels.
Vitamin C is essential for healing wounds, and for repairing and maintaining bones and teeth. Benefits: Boosting immune system function Maintaining healthy gums Improving vision.
